Lindo Ferretti and Zamboni's CCCP are ready to get back on track by giving their aficionados (including the writer) a new tour (Ultima Chiamata) that will see them busy throughout 2025.
The ensemble, founded in what was then West Berlin in 1982, includes among its members, in addition to the previously mentioned Giovanni Lindo-Ferretti and Massimo Zamboni, also Annarella Giudici and Danilo Fatur.
Joining them on the tour will be: Luca Rossi (bass, Ustmamò), Simone Filippi (guitar, Ustmamò, Deproducers), Ezio Bonicelli (violin, Ustmamò), Simone Beneventi (percussion) and Gabriele Genta (percussion). The band will play at the Circo Massimo in Rome on June 30, on July 3 in Legnano, on July 8 at the former NATO base in Naples, on July 12 at the Fiera del Levante in Bari, on July 18 in Piazzola sul Brenta (Padua), on July 24 in Rimini and on July 30 at the Teatro Antico in Taormina.
Tickets for the “Ultima Chiamata” tour will be available from 12pm on Monday 24th February.
